Learning Objectives:
- Review the prevalence of vasomotor symptoms
- Name 3 risk factors that are associated with more severe vasomotor symptoms
- Name 3 non-hormonal treatments that are effective for vasomotor symptoms Â
Hot flashes and night sweats are a significant complaint among women around the menopause transition. Not only are they disruptive to quality of life, but they also carry broader health risks. This lecture reviews the demographics of hot flashes, risk factors that contribute to their onset and severity, and the health risks associated with vasomotor symptoms. Treatment options are reviewed with an emphasis on non-hormonal therapies, as hormone-specific treatments are covered in other lectures
